Frequently Asked Questions about Port Charlotte
How much are Studio apartments in Port Charlotte?
There are currently 9 Studio Apartments in Port Charlotte with rent ranges from $1,125 to $1,933 with an average price of $1,344.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Port Charlotte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Port Charlotte ranges from $944 to $2,555 with an average monthly rent of $1,802.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Port Charlotte c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Port Charlotte range from $1,200 to $4,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,895.
How expensive are Port Charlotte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 30 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Port Charlotte on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,350 to $6,000 - averaging $2,272 for the location.
